For a point of reference, I have had LookSmart non-paid links (Zeal) that have given me a PR5 with no other links. I have also had links that have given me a PR3. It definitely depends on what category you are in and how many outgoing links on your site, as well as many other factors.
I don't really understand why backlinks aren't included in Google but I assume they aren't included because it would be redundant to add directory categories from ODP, LS, MSN, AV, etc, when Google is really only teamed with ODP and Yahoo.
With that said, whether or not LookSmart / Zeal is as important in calculating pagerank as ODP or Yahoo, it definitely helps your pagerank if you have the link.
